Pedestrian Killed In Valencia Crash Identified By Coroner

The pedestrian who was hit by a car near Valencia Boulevard and The Old Road in Valencia on Tuesday evening, has been identified as 18-year-old Albert Castro, of Castaic, Los Angeles County Department of Coroner and California Highway Patrol officials confirmed on Wednesday.

Castro was pronounced dead at Henry Mayo Newhall Memorial Hospital at 11 p.m. on Tuesday, said Coroner’s Office Spokesman Ed Winter.

As of Wednesday morning, the cause of death had not yet been determined.

Castro had been riding his skateboard eastbound across The Old Road at 5:25 p.m. on Tuesday, when he was struck by a 2002 Honda travelling northbound on The Old Road, driven by Ranu Junprunh, 54, of Saugus, according to a CHP report.

Castro was thrown into the roadway and sustained major injuries. He was treated on scene and later transported to Henry Mayo.

No arrests have been made in connection with this incident, and the investigation is ongoing.
